You have "Direct Ignition", not injection Posted by Jonathan Scupin [Email] (#428) [Profile/Gallery] (more from Jonathan Scupin) on Sat, 23 Feb 2008 18:28:32 In Reply to: Re: Direct injection.., Brian C, Sat, 23 Feb 2008 17:44:10 Members do not see ads below this line. - Help Keep This Site Online - Signup |
Direct Ignition = coil on each plug electronic distributorless ignition which also handles the function of knock detection.
Direct Injection = fuel under high pressure is injected directly into each cylinder
Saabs in recent history have all injected fuel into the intake manifold runners, which is generic "fuel injection"
